Pivot Table Subtotals
 
Hi, I have been using pivot tables and suddenly the arrow (cursor) that we
get to select specific colums is not to been seen. It just shows the normal +
cursor on the page and i am unable to select specific rows globally. Please
also help me in getting the subtotal of specific rows that i want. Its shows
the subtotal but without any figure on it. Can any one please help me out.
Thanks a lot and have a nice week ahead.

Regards.. siyer.

Debra Dalgleish

You may have to enable selection -- from the Pivot toolbar, choose
PivotTableSelect, and click on Enable Selection

Thanks indeed for your help. I have one more question, is it possible to sum
specific rows in Pivots?

You may be able to create a calculated item that adds specific items in
a pivot field. (Pivot Table toolbar, PivotTableFormulasCalculated Item)
